If you make protein shakes with coffee, make the shake first, make some coffee (slightly cooler than normal, perhaps) then add the shake to it as you would milk. Otherwise, the protein will denature upon impact with the hot coffee and you'll essentially get lumpy coffee.

So, afaik, cellulite is caused by a network of collagen which lies over subcutaneous fat and causes a sort of 'orange peel' appearance as that which isn't 'held down' by the collagen is able to push through the gaps. The only real way to deal with it is to lower your body fat percentage as less fat = less 'popping through'…
